Selecting Talkers
Shelf talkers are designed to be printed out four to a page.
To print talkers you must first go to the talker listing by
clicking on the "Shelf Talker" link from the top
navigation or from any of the individual viewer pages. From
the talker listing you may select as many talkers as you want
to print by clicking on the check box beside the product name.
Once you have selected products click the "Print"
button at the bottom of the page.

Printing Talkers
When the "Print" button at the very bottom of the
talker list is clicked a web page displaying all the talkers
you have selected will appear. Check to make sure you have
selected all of the talkers you want to print. To add or delete
talkers from this page simply use the browser's back button
to return to the listing and either check or uncheck the desired
boxes and click "Print" again. To print the page
just use the browser's print function and the selected talkers
will print four to a page. For best results use a color inkjet
printer or color laser printer.

Set Print Margins
For talkers to print properly you must set the printer's
margins in "Page Setup" under the "File"
menu. Set the margins to 0.25 inches all around. The four
talkers on each page will then be centered on the page with
equal margin all around.
